Output 2f95cae93dfe6f04f62d0c43c54bb5e706b222569b6de6da79600b9a086ddef8:4

value
10838381
script pubkey
OP_HASH160 OP_PUSHBYTES_20 374783ed4fe9b9e21fb72e0d411dd0eb875599f3 OP_EQUAL
address
MCwT4xGnfVaUNAZcugn1FtNW3YvRbbX5Wg
transaction
2f95cae93dfe6f04f62d0c43c54bb5e706b222569b6de6da79600b9a086ddef8
spent
true